solr

以下是为您整理出来关于【solr】合集内容,如果觉得还不错,请帮忙转发推荐。

【solr】技术教程文章

Spark streaming + Kafka 流式数据处理,结果存储至MongoDB、Solr、Neo4j(自用)【代码】

KafkaStreaming.scala文件import kafka.serializer.StringDecoder import org.apache.spark.SparkConf import org.apache.spark.streaming.{Seconds, StreamingContext} import org.apache.spark.streaming.kafka.{KafkaManagerAdd, KafkaUtils} import org.json4s.DefaultFormats import org.json4s.jackson.Json import com.mongodb.casbah.{MongoClient, MongoClientURI, MongoCollection}import scala.collection.mutable.Arra...

Solr7使用Oracle数据源导入+中文分词

oracle.jdbc.driver.OracleDriver" url="jdbc:oracle:thin:@192.168.2.218:1521:product " user="数据库用户名" password="数据库密码" /><document name=”product” pk=”主键”><entity name="bless" query="select * from bless"<--这里配查询语句--> deltaImportQuery="SELECT * FROM userinfo where UserID=‘${dih.delta.spuid}‘" deltaQuery="select bless_id from bless where bless_time > ‘${dataimporter.last_index...

Solr数据库导入【图】

遇到的问题1:mysql java.sql.SQLException: Unknown system variable ‘language&#03 一:问题描述:mysql测试连接一致报错:Unknown system variable ‘language‘ 未知名的系统变量语言 二:用的Mysql的版本 5.6 用的连接 jar mysql-connector-java-5.1.36.jar 三:找到问题,mysql-connector-java-5.1.36.jar版本太高了,换成 mysql-connector-java-5.1.24.jar 问题解决! 遇到的问题2:   把solr-6.0\solr...

solr的DIH操作同步mysql数据

<requestHandler name="/dataimport" class="org.apache.solr.handler.dataimport.DataImportHandler"> <lst name="defaults"> <str name="config">data-config.xml</str> </lst> </requestHandler>2)在同目录下添加data-config.xmlvim /home/solrhome/collection1/conf/data-config.xml<?xml version="1.0" encoding="UTF-8"?><dataConfig><dataSource type="JdbcDataSource" driver="com.mysql.jdbc.Driver" url="jdbc:mysql://...

Solr5.5.5 学习 二 配置数据库【图】

<dataConfig> 2 <dataSource type="JdbcDataSource" driver="com.mysql.jdbc.Driver" url="jdbc:mysql://localhost:3306/test" user="root" password="jimw"/> 3 <document> 4 <entity name="test" query="select * from t_customer"> 5 <field column="id" name="id" /> 6 <field column="name" name="name" /> 7 </entity> 8 </document> 9 </dataConfig>jdbc 配置所需要query的...

solr搜索之mysql导入数据到solr(四)【图】

mysql导入数据到solr方式一:创建项目,查询出数据,一条一条add到solr中;(不推荐)方式二:通过配置复制数据到solr中以上已完成了在本地window8中对solr的部署,为solr添加了一个自定义的coredemo,并且引入了ik分词器。那么该如何将本地的mysql的数据导入到solr中呢?1.1 准备工作1.1.1 准备数据源mysql数据源:test库中的user表(7条数据),其中这个update_time字段是用于solr更新数据库数据的依据,表中必须得有这个字...

solr5.5.4 增量索引 自动同步mysql数据【图】

前言:之前测试了solr好几个版本都没有成功,solr比较好下载的版本5.0,5.5,6.6。solr6.6结合tomcat8做自动同步mysql数据一直报错,然后果断测试5.5版本的,成功了。 环境:windows10, jdk1.8,tomcat8,solr5.5.4 实现功能:通过前端输入关键字查询,同时查询多表多字段。当数据库mysql添加或者更新数据的时候,数据自动更新到solr引擎中。 正文: 第一步:下载solr 1.solr5.5下载:http://apache.fayea.com/lucene/solr/,...

solr6.6教程-从mysql数据库中导入数据(三)【代码】【图】

Type:表示这个字段的类型是什么,string是字符串类型,int是整形数据类型,date是时间类型,相当于数据库里面的timestamp Indexed:是否索引 Stored:是否存储 multiValued:是否多值。在一个域下存储多个值。一个域下存储一个数组。 在managed_schema后面添加如下代码<!--这里无需定义id,因为managed_schema文件已经在前面开头位置定义了,id是必须,并且唯一的--> <field name="S_user" type="string" indexed="true" stored="t...

使用Solr索引MySQL数据【代码】

DataBase Name: mybatis Table Name: user Db.sql 1 SET FOREIGN_KEY_CHECKS=0;2 -- ----------------------------3 -- Table structure for `user`4 -- ----------------------------5 DROP TABLE IF EXISTS `user`;6 7 CREATE TABLE `user` (8 `id` int(11) NOT NULL AUTO_INCREMENT,9 `userName` varchar(50) DEFAULT NULL, 10 `userAge` int(11) DEFAULT NULL, 11 `userAddress` varchar(200) DEFAULT NULL, 12 PRIM...

Solr6.5与mysql集成建立索引【代码】

首先在solrconfig.xml(我的是保存在/usr/local/tomcat/solrhome/mycore/conf/下)的<requestHandler name="/select" class="solr.SearchHandler">之上添加 (我的本地的solrconfig.xml中有这个/dtatimport 只需把class修改为下面的就可以了) <requestHandler name="/dataimport" class="org.apache.solr.handler.dataimport.DataImportHandler"> <lst name="defaults"> <str name="config">data-config.xml</str> </lst> </re...

SOLR - 相关标签